Sharing restaurant recommendations just got a whole lot easier.
You can now make customized lists of places on Google Maps, the company announced in a blog post on Monday. The lists are shareable within the Google Maps app, and you can follow lists you're interested in -- to make sure you're always apprised of the best local pizza places, say. The feature was previously available only to Google's "Local Guides," and it's now being rolled out to all users.
To create a list, just open a place on Google Maps. Then, tap on the place name and the save icon, which brings up several pre-set lists like "Want to Go" or "Favorites." You can also create and name a new list. To view your saved lists, you can go to "Your Places" in the side menu. Your lists can be viewed on both the desktop and mobile apps, and you'll even be able to view them offline if you download the relevant area in advance.
Perhaps the most compelling part of the lists feature is being able to share and follow lists. Being able to share and follow lists is a great feature for travel, restaurant recommendations and road trip route planning -- as Yelp and Foursquare users have known for a long time.
Having the feature in Google Maps itself is extremely useful, as it lets you view places on your lists that are nearby directly from the map view.
Google has slowly but surely been evolving Maps beyond simply finding you directions into a powerful tool that helps you plan your day. With features like parking, shortcuts for your surroundings and "popular times", Google Maps is getting closer and closer to being the only app you need to get around.
